Best lakes around Eydelstedt are primarily found in the surrounding region, with Dümmer Lake being a significant natural attraction. Dümmer Lake is the second-largest lake in Lower Saxony, Germany, offering extensive recreational opportunities. The area features diverse landscapes including meadows, forests, and fens, making it an important biotope for migratory birds. This region provides a variety of natural features for outdoor activities.

The most prominent lake near Eydelstedt is Dümmer Lake, the second-largest lake in Lower Saxony. It is a significant natural attraction known for its diverse landscapes, water sports, and as an important biotope for migratory birds.
The region offers diverse natural features, including meadows, forests, fens, and raised bogs, especially around Dümmer Lake. You can observe extensive reedbeds and a variety of flora and fauna. For example, Great Sea is a natural lake offering opportunities for wildlife observation, while Varenescher Ponds are picturesque fishponds set in a beautiful natural environment.
Yes, Dümmer Lake is an excellent destination for water sports enthusiasts. Its shallow average depth makes it ideal for sailing, windsurfing, kitesurfing, and canoeing. Several clubs provide infrastructure for these activities.
Around Dümmer Lake, there is a popular 27-kilometer circular path perfect for cycling, hiking, and running. Additionally, you can explore various routes in the wider region. Absolutely. Dümmer Lake features three large sandy beaches, playgrounds, and opportunities for swimming and relaxation, making it very family-friendly. The Beach bar at Hartensbergsee also offers a cozy spot with play facilities for children, and the Huntesee campsite provides a simple and uncomplicated setting for families.
Oehlener See, a former lake now characterized by wet meadows within a forest, is known as a dog-friendly area. It's a popular meeting place for dog owners to romp with their pets.
The lakes are enjoyable year-round. During warmer months, Dümmer Lake is ideal for water sports, swimming, and cycling. In colder months, when the ice is stable, Dümmer Lake transforms into a playground for ice skating, ice hockey, and ice sailing, offering unique winter activities.
Near Dümmer Lake, you can find cultural attractions such as the Lembruch Heimathaus, which offers insights into local history, and the historic Hünnefeld Castle. These provide opportunities to explore the region's heritage alongside its natural beauty.
At Dümmer Lake, you'll find beach bars for refreshments and several sailing and windsurfing clubs. The Beach bar at Hartensbergsee is a quaint and cozy spot with great views and treats. For accommodation, the Huntesee campsite offers a simple and clean option.
